The world of mobile gaming is filled with diverse niches, and the "weight gain" (WG) subgenre has carved out a dedicated following on the Android platform. These games typically focus on character growth, resource management, and narrative progression centered around physical transformation. However, many players seek "patched" versions of these titles to bypass restrictive paywalls, unlock premium content, or access community-made expansions. A patched Android game is an APK (Android Package) file that has been modified by a third party. For WG games, these patches generally serve three purposes:
Currency Unlocks: Providing unlimited in-game money or gems to buy food items and outfits.
Content Restoration: Some games are censored for official app stores; patches can restore "adult" or high-detail transformations.
Feature Expansion: Community developers often add new sprites, storylines, or mechanics that weren't in the original release. Popular Titles Often Seeking Patches

Most patches for these games are created using tools like Lucky Patcher or by manually decompiling the APK to edit the game’s logic (often written in C# via Unity or Python via Ren'Py). For the end-user, this usually means downloading a pre-modified APK file rather than applying the patch themselves. Safety and Risks
While the allure of "unlimited resources" is strong, downloading patched games from unofficial sources carries risks. Users should be wary of: Malware: Unverified APKs can contain trackers or adware.
Save Data Corruption: Patched versions may not be compatible with official cloud saves.
Account Bans: If a game has online leaderboards or social features, using a modified client can lead to a permanent ban. Where the Community Thrives
